#1ebb5b h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#1ebb5b is composed of 11.8% red, 73.3% green and 35.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84% cyan, 0% magenta, 51.3%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 143.3 degrees, a saturation of 72.4% and a lightness of 42.5%. #1ebb5b color hex could be obtained by blending #3cffb6 with #007700. Closest websafe color is: #33cc66.

● #1ebb5b color description : Strong cyan - lime green.
The hexadecimal color #1ebb5b has RGB values of R:30, G:187, B:91 and CMYK values of C:0.84, M:0, Y:0.51,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 2014043.
